Mr. Gerald C. Brennan of Car-
dinal, cousin of the groom, was best
man. The ushers were Mr, Balton I
E. 1psdell and , Mr. George C.
Pierce, bath of Hamilton, brother-
in-law and brother of the bride.
Oil The bride's mother wore a street -
length frock of grey printed crepe,
white hat end whit- accessories and
wore a corsage of red roses. The
groom's mother chose a frock of rose)
flowered silk, trimmed with black.
a black felt picture hat and black
accessories. She wore a corsage of
ivory camelias.
A reception was held at Corner
Houf;e. 416 Main Street East, Ham-
ilton to some thirty guests.
The groom's gift to the bride was
a gold necklace set with pearls and
to the groomsman, a gold key chain,
and to the ushers, leather wallets.I
The bride's gift to the groom was a
Ronson lighter, to the bridesmaid, a
gold compact, and to the flower girl
!
a gold ring.
The happy ,couple left later on a
!wedding trip to the Muskoka Dis-
trrot. and then to points East.
For travelling, the bride. donned
a pink moire taffeta snit, black hat
and black accessories and wore a
corsage of deep pink roses and corn-
flower. • .
They will reside at 263 Dundurn
St., South, Hamilton, Ontario.
Tbey received many beautiful
gifts and congratulatory messages,
including .a telegram from relatives
in Cornwall, Ontario.
Those attending from a distance
were Mr. and Mrs. Thomas Pierce,
of Brussels; Mr. and Mrs. D, B.
MacDonald, Ross, Keith and Ruth,
of Staffa; Mr. and Mrs, E. A. Coons,
of Cardinal; Mr. and Mrs. Sylvester
Brennan and son Gerald, of Oar-
dinal.
